
AEW Road Rager is a professional wrestling television special, a genre known for its live-action sports entertainment featuring scripted matches, athleticism, dramatic storylines, and larger-than-life characters. Typical elements of this genre include intense wrestling bouts, charismatic wrestlers, ongoing story arcs that blend competition with personal rivalries, and a live audience atmosphere to heighten excitement. What makes AEW Road Rager stand out from other TV movie titles is its significance as a milestone event marking the return of live touring during the COVID-19 pandemic, showcasing AEW's commitment to engaging fans in person after a pandemic-induced hiatus. Additionally, as part of AEW's 'Welcome Back' tour, it featured high-profile matches and was notable for its substantial attendance, making it one of the largest wrestling events held during the pandemic era.
